Archive pour la catĂ©gorie ‘Programmation’

9 août 2011

CMS : Pourquoi Drupal?

Drupal est un système de gestion de contenu, ou CMS (d’après l’anglais Content Management System). Concrètement, c’est une application qui permet de construire des sites Web qui requièrent beaucoup de fonctions d’administration. Drupal permet par exemple de publier des articles en ligne, de construire des blogs ou des forums, de fĂ©dĂ©rer des communautĂ©s d’utilisateurs autour d’un thème prĂ©cis et bien d’autres fonctions encore. (Lire la suite…)

EN SAVOIR PLUS | Les commentaires sont fermés

Mots-clés : , , ,

31 mai 2011

La tendance Python

Nous ne parlerons pas dans ce billet des imprimĂ©s lĂ©opards et des prochaines tendances mode mais plutĂ´t du « langage de l’annĂ©e 2010 » selon l’indice TIOBE.
Quels sont ses avantages vis-Ă -vis de PHP? Quelques explications sur la montĂ©e en popularitĂ© de Python. (Lire la suite…)

EN SAVOIR PLUS | 1 commentaire »

Mots-clés : , , ,

12 novembre 2010

jQuery : comment trouver le type de balise (tagName) d’un Ă©lĂ©ment

Durant votre frénétique et exaltante programmation JavaScript utilisant la librairie jQuery, vous aurez peut-être besoin de récupérer, à la volée, le type de balise (tagName) que votre script manipule.

Par exemple, un de vos plugins pourrait avoir besoin de valider que l’Ă©lĂ©ment ciblĂ© par le sĂ©lecteur soit obligatoirement un a, div, table, etc.

(Lire la suite…)

EN SAVOIR PLUS | Les commentaires sont fermés

Mots-clés : , , , ,

10 novembre 2010

Mobile-friendly : Le guide d’optimisation Web pour téléphone mobile – 2/3

Photo d'une petite fille avec un téléphone mobile.

Voici la seconde partie de la traduction de Mobile-friendly: The mobile web optimization guide de Bruce Lawson, publiĂ© originalement le 28 juillet 2010 sur le site Web dev.opera.com. J’ai scindĂ© ce guide en trois billets question de le rendre plus digestible. Aujourd’hui je vous prĂ©sente les deux premières stratĂ©gie : StratĂ©gie #1 Bien coder et ne rien faire de particulier pour les tĂ©lĂ©phones mobiles, StratĂ©gie #2 : Faire un site « mobile » Ă  part… Bonne lecture.

(Lire la suite…)

EN SAVOIR PLUS | 3 commentaires »

Mots-clés : , ,

8 octobre 2010

Mobile-friendly : Le guide d’optimisation Web pour tĂ©lĂ©phone mobile – 1/3

Ce texte est une traduction de Mobile-friendly: The mobile web optimization guide de Bruce Lawson, il a Ă©tĂ© publiĂ© originalement le 28 juillet 2010 sur le site Web dev.opera.com. Ce document sera scinder ici en trois billets question de le rendre plus digestible. Aujourd’hui je vous prĂ©sente les trois premières sections, c’est-Ă -dire : Introduction, Les difficultĂ©s de la conception Web multi-plateformes, Vous devez vous rappeler de ceci… Bonne lecture.

(Lire la suite…)

EN SAVOIR PLUS | 2 commentaires »

Mots-clés : , , , ,

30 août 2010

Le web sĂ©mantique par l’exemple : la vCard

Logos microformats et Semantic Web

Dans mon premier billet sur le sujet, explicitement intitulĂ© Qu’est-ce que le Web sĂ©mantique : Une introduction, j’expliquais que le Web sĂ©mantique Ă©tait simplement une syntaxe pour dĂ©crire les choses afin que les ordinateurs puissent les « comprendre » et les traiter. Le Web sĂ©mantique n’a pas pour but de crĂ©er des liens entre les pages Web, il permet plutĂ´t aux machines de tisser des liens entre les choses (ressources) et de dĂ©terminer les propriĂ©tĂ©s de ces choses.

Ainsi des outils « sĂ©mantiques » peuvent dĂ©finir que, dans un texte le mot « orange » fasse rĂ©fĂ©rence Ă  une couleur, un agrume ou une ville amĂ©ricaine.

Mais je vous entends dire «C’est bien beau tout ça, mais au-delĂ  de la thĂ©orie oĂą sont les exemples concrets et par oĂą commencer ?» … Et bien allons-y toute suite et faisons du Web sĂ©mantique avec un type de contenu qui se retrouve sur pratiquement tous les sites Web : les coordonnĂ©es de la page contact !

(Lire la suite…)

EN SAVOIR PLUS | 1 commentaire »

Mots-clés : , , , , , , , ,

16 juillet 2010

Colonnes à hauteurs égales en jQuery

Voici un petit bout de code jQuery servant Ă  modifier la hauteur de plusieurs colonnes en fonction de la plus haute.

(Lire la suite…)

EN SAVOIR PLUS | 2 commentaires »

Mots-clés : , , , , , ,

9 juillet 2010

Le raccourcissement d’un texte trop long en PHP

Il arrive souvent qu’un texte doit ĂŞtre Ă©courtĂ© avant son affichage. Par exemple, si vous voulez afficher sur votre page d’accueil un extrait du contenu d’une nouvelle rĂ©cente qui est très long, vous devrez couper votre texte après un nombre dĂ©fini de caractères ou de mots. (Lire la suite…)

EN SAVOIR PLUS | Les commentaires sont fermés

Mots-clés : , , , ,

18 juin 2010

La boucle alphabet en PHP

Voici un moyen simple et rapide d’afficher toutes les lettres de l’alphabet en utilisant une boucle. (Lire la suite…)

EN SAVOIR PLUS | Les commentaires sont fermés

Mots-clés : , , , , , ,

4 juin 2010

Au pied ! comment maintenir les « footers » toujours au bas de votre page

Footer toujours au bas de votre page

Quand une page HTML contient peu de contenu, le pied de page a tendance Ă  se retrouver Ă  mi-chemin de la page en laissant un espace important en dessous. Cela n’est pas très esthĂ©tique, en particulier sur un Ă©cran Ă  haute rĂ©solution. En gĂ©nĂ©ral nous voulons que notre « footer » soit toujours au mĂŞme endroit, c’est-Ă -dire appuyĂ© sur le bord infĂ©rieur de la fenĂŞtre de notre navigateur Web.

Les concepteurs Web utilisent souvent JavaScript pour contourner ce problème, mais aujourd’hui je vais vous prĂ©senter deux techniques qui ont uniquement recoures Ă  XHTML et CSS. Celles-ci fonctionnent avec tous les navigateurs respectant les standards et  Ă©chouent gracieusement dans les anciens navigateurs. De plus, ces techniques n’utilisent que du CSS standard et valide ne contenant aucun « hack ».

(Lire la suite…)

EN SAVOIR PLUS | 3 commentaires »

Mots-clés : , , , , , , , , ,